I'm an economics major at Syracuse, the Whitman school has really good programs like trips down to NYC to network with IB and accounting firms. Is it a semi-target? Definitely not, it does well regionally from what I've seen but not anything compared to Fordham. Fordham has the advantage of being in NYC so I'm guessing it places much better.

Best advice if you're considering Syracuse and want to place in IB, you need a high gpa, extracurriculars like clubs or greek life and take part in either the SU Investment Club or if you get into Whitman the Orange Value Fund. Both are great experiences. They also have a small business consulting group you might be interested in. Biggest downside besides not being a target is the price tag, you may be better off somewhere else.
